Polygonum longista
Persicaria longiseta
Persicaria longiseta is a common perennial plant found in Korea. Its growth characteristics, propagation methods, cultivation methods, garden uses, and major pests and diseases, as well as control methods, can be described as follows. Growth CharacteristicsPersicaria longiseta thrives primarily in moist environments and prefers sunny spots. It generally prefers neutral to slightly acidic soil and grows healthily in well-drained soil. The stems grow upright, and the leaves are alternate and lanceolate. From late summer to autumn, small pink or white flowers bloom in slender inflorescences. Propagation MethodsPersicaria longiseta is primarily propagated by seeds and reproduces easily in its natural state. It can also be propagated by cutting and transplanting stems. Mature seeds should be collected in the autumn, refrigerated, and then sown in early spring. Cultivation MethodsPersicaria longiseta is a plant that is relatively easy to cultivate. It requires moderate humidity and sunlight, and grows best in well-drained soil. While frequent watering is not necessary, care should be taken to ensure the soil does not become too dry. In early spring, it is beneficial to replenish nutrients using compost or fertilizer. Uses in the GardenPolygonum longisetta is primarily used in gardens for ornamental purposes. It is suitable for creating a natural atmosphere and blends easily with other plants. It is particularly well-suited for use as a border plant or background plant. Important Pests and Control MethodsPolygonum longisetta is relatively resistant and does not easily suffer from major pests; however, it may occasionally be affected by aphids or slugs. To prevent this, periodically check the condition of the leaves. If necessary, you can physically remove pests or use appropriate insecticides for control. For eco-friendly control, you can also consider spraying diluted garlic or vinegar. Based on this information, you will be able to successfully cultivate and manage Polygonum longisetta.
